Vous êtes sur la page 1sur 7

UNIVERSIDAD NACIONAL DEL ALTIPLANO FACULTAD DE INGENIERA MECNICA ELCTRICA, ELECTRNICA Y SISTEMAS ESCUELA PROFESIONAL DE INGENIERA MECNICA ELCTRICA

PROBLEMAS PROPUESTOS SISTEMAS DIGITALES


1. Convierta las siguientes funciones de Boole a formas de sumas de productos cannicos: a. f(w, x, y, z) b. f(u, v, w, x, y) c. f(u, w, x, y, z) = = = wy + x(w + yz) v(w + u) (x + y) + uwy (x + z) (z + wy) + (vz + wx) (y + z)

2. Empleando los mapas de Karnaugh, determine las expresiones de suma de productos mnimos de las siguientes funciones: a. b. c. d. f(a,b,c,d) f(w, x, y, z) f(a, b, c, d) f(v, w, x, y, z) = = = = m(0, 4, 6, 10, 11, 13) m(3, 4, 5, 7, 11, 12, 14, 15) M(3, 5, 7, 11, 13, 15) m(0, 2, 3 ,4, 5, 11, 18, 19, 20, 23, 24, 28 ,29, 31)

3. Un nmero primo es un nmero que solo es divisible por si mismo, y por uno. Suponga que los nmeros entre 0 y 31 son representados en binarios en la forma de cinco bits X4X3X2X1X0, donde X4 es el bit ms significativo. Disee un detector de nmeros primos. Es decir, disee un circuito de lgica combinacional cuya salida, Z, ser 1 si y solo si los 5 bits de entrada representan a un nmero primo. No considere al 0 como nmero primo. 4. En un cierto computador, tres secciones separadas del computador actan (funcionan) independientemente a travs de cuatro fases de operacin. Para propsitos de control, es necesario conocer cuando dos de las tres secciones estn en la misma fase al mismo tiempo, cada seccin coloca una seal de dos bits (00, 01, 10, 11) en paralelo en dos lneas. Disear un circuito que entregue una seal siempre que reciba la misma seal de fase de dos cualesquiera de las tres secciones. 5. Cuatro tanques de gran capacidad de una planta qumica contienen diferentes lquidos sometidos a calentamiento. Se utilizan sensores de nivel de lquido para detectar si el nivel de los tanques A y B excede un nivel predeterminado. Los sensores de temperatura de los tanques C y D detectan cuando la temperatura de estos tanques desciende de un lmite prescrito. Suponga que las salidas A y B del sensor de nivel de lquido son BAJOS cuando el nivel es satisfactorio y ALTOS cuando es demasiado alto. Asimismo, las salidas C y D del sensor de la temperatura son BAJAS cuando la temperatura es satisfactoria y ALTAS cuando la temperatura es demasiado baja. Disee un circuito lgico que detecte el nivel del tanque A o B cuando es demasiado alto al mismo tiempo que la temperatura en el tanque C o en el D cuando es demasiado baja. 6. En la figura se muestra el cruce de una autopista principal con un camino de acceso secundario. Se colocan sensores de deteccin de vehculos a lo largo de los carriles C y D (camino principal) y en los carriles A y B (camino de acceso). Las salidas del sensor son BAJA (0) cuando no pasa ningn vehculo y ALTA (1) cuando pasa algn vehculo. El semforo del crucero se controlar de acuerdo con la siguiente lgica: 1. El semforo E - O estar en luz verde siempre que los carriles C y D estn ocupados. 2. El semforo E - O estar en luz verde siempre que C o D estn ocupados pero A y B no estn ocupados.

3. El semforo N - S estar en luz verde siempre que los carriles A y B estn ocupados pero C y D no lo estn. 4. el semforo N - S tambin estar en luz verde cuando A o B estn ocupados en tanto que C y D estn vacos. 5. El semforo E - O estar en luz verde cuando no haya vehculos transitando. Utilizando las salidas del sensor A, B, C y D como entradas, disee un circuito lgico para controlar el semforo. Debe haber dos salidas N/S y E/O, que pasen ALTO cuando la luz correspondiente se pone verde. Simplifique el circuito lo ms que sea posible y enliste todos los pasos.

7. Reduzca las siguientes expresiones de Boole (utilizando el lgebra de Boole) al nmero de literales solicitado al frente de cada una de ellas. a. b. c. d. ABC + ABC + ABC + ABC + ABC BC + AC +AB + BCD ( (CD) + A) + A + CD +AB (A + C + D)(A + C + D)(A + C + D)(A + B) a cinco literales. a cuatro literales. a tres literales a cuatro literales

8. Un sistema de control en un rotor, puede detectar en cul de cuatro fases se encuentra ste. Para cierta aplicacin, se utilizan tres de estos rotores y se debe activar una seal siempre que dos o tres rotores se encuentren en la misma fase. Disee el circuito mnimo correspondiente en producto de sumas. 9. Disee un circuito que compare dos nmeros de 4 bits A y B (comparador de magnitudes), El resultado de la comparacin se debe especificar por medio de tres variables binarias que indican cuando A > B, A = B, A < B. 10. Disear e implementar un conversor binario a BCD o binario a hexadecimal (HEX), de tal manera que una palabra de cuatro bits pueda ser mostrada como su equivalente BCD o hexadecimal en un display de 7 segmentos (Ver la siguiente figura.)

La seal S es una entrada de habilitacin, con el fin de poder realizar la seleccin entre la conversin deseada: BIN a BCD o BIN a HEX. Cuando S est activa (S=1), el modo de operacin es conversin binaria a hexadecimal de tal forma que se despliegan nmeros del 0 al 9 y de la A a la F; por el contrario si S=0, entonces realice conversiones de BIN a BCD, es decir solo aparecen cdigos del 0 al 9, esto conlleva a que los nmeros binarios del 10 al 15 no se visualizaran en el display de 7 segmentos. La siguiente tabla resume la palabra binaria de entrada y el equivalente hexadecimal que debe ser mostrado en el display.

11. Se desea disear, un circuito digital para un edificio de 10 (Piso 1 hasta el 10) pisos con ascensor, el cual cumpla los siguientes requerimientos: a. Se debe visualizar desde un centro de control, el nmero del piso en el cual se encuentra el modulo de transporte del ascensor. b. El modulo ascensor, esta controlado por motor DC (Polaridad + -), en el momento en que se encuentre en el piso 1, debe asegurarse que el motor para (Ascensor en reposo) si no existe nadie dentro del mismo. c. Si el modulo del ascensor se encuentra vaci y fuera del piso 1, debe asegurar el sistema de control a disear que lleve el modulo ascensor hasta el primer piso. d. Un usuario solicita el ascensor, presionado un pulsador ubicado en cada piso hasta que el sistema de control lleve el ascensor hasta encontrar el piso del botn presionado. e. Dentro del ascensor se encuentra 3 botones, para el usuario, el primero de ellos indica una flecha hacia arriba, un segundo stop y el ltimo botn indica flecha hacia abajo. Si un usuario se desea desplazar hacia otro piso, solo debe mantener pulsado el botn que le convenga (Arriba y abajo) hasta llegar a su destino. f. El ascensor puede parar en cualquier momento presionado el botn STOP. 12. Defina Uds. los conceptos de: y y y y y y y y BIT DE PARIDAD FAN OUT FAMILIAS DE CIRCUITOS INTEGRADOS Y SUS DIFERENCIAS (TTL, ECL, MOS, CMOS, I2L) LOGICA POSITIVA Y NEGATIVA CODIGO BCD, GRAY, EXCESO 3 Y SUS APLICACIONES MULTIPLEXOR, DEMULTIPLEXOR, CODIFICADOR, DECODIFICADOR. REGISTROS Y TRANSMISIN DE REGISTROS. IMPORTANCIA DE LOS SISTEMAS DIGITALES.

13. Un sistema mecnico como el de la foto, pose un encoger que pose una codificacin binaria (D3 a D0) Gray, en funcin de la posicin del sensor, Pues este dispositivo es utilizado para medir la direccin del viento en un sistema de navegacin. El sistema codifica los valores (Ver tabla) en funcin del sistema de orientacin: Valor Grados 0000 180 0001 210 0011 240 0010 270 0110 300 0111 330 0101 0 0100 30 1100 60 1101 120 Figura: Equipo de Orientacin. 1111 150 1010 E Los valores E en la anterior tabla son considerados como errores de 1011 E funcionamiento. 1001 E E Disee un circuito lgico que decodifique la informacin del sistema 1 0 0 0 de posicin mediante puntos luminosos en un mapa de cuadrantes, que indiquen la direccin del Viento. El sistema debe Mediante un despliegue Indicar El cuadrante en el cual se encuentra, y en otros dos Despliegues de 7 segmentos, los grados de referencia a Cero, para dicho cuadrante. Nota, 120 se simboliza: 2 (Segundo Cuadrante) y 120-90 = 30 (Debe aparecer en un despliegue) 1er Cuadrante 1, 2er Cuadrante 2, 3er Cuadrante 3, 4er Cuadrante 4 14. Se desea disear un sistema de deteccin de incendios para un edificio de 2 plantas. Cada planta dispone de 1 pulsador de alarma (P1 para la planta 1 y P2 para la segunda). Adems desde el centro de control puede activarse una seal de inhibicin para cada planta (I1 e I2) una vez que se tiene conocimiento de la alarma. Como respuesta a la pulsacin, el sistema genera 3 salidas: dos para indicar en qu piso se activ un pulsador (A2 y A1) y una tercera de alarma general (A). el mecanismo detallado de funcionamiento del sistema ser el siguiente: y y y Si se activa el pulsador de un piso se activaran la seal de alarma de dicho piso. Si la seal de inhibicin de un piso determinado esta a 1 no se debe activar la alarma de ese piso. Si se produce alarma en cualquier piso debe activarse la seal A de alarma general.

Se pide: a) b) c) d) Completar la tabla de verdad. Implementar la salida A en forma de suma de productos. Implementar la salida A2 mediante un decodificador activo a nivel alto. Implementar la salida A1 mediante un multiplexor 8 @ 1 ms la lgica combinacional necesaria, teniendo en cuenta que las seales de control deben ser

15. Sean F1 !

m(5,6,13) y F2 ! 4 m(0,1,3,5,8,9,10,11,13) . Encontrar una funcin F3 tal

que F1 ! F2 F3 .

16. Un sistema sencillo para hacer votacin secreta es utilizar un circuito combinacional cuyas entradas estn controladas por interruptores que puedan accionar los miembros del jurado. La salida del circuito ser 0 1 en funcin de como hayan puesto los interruptores la mayora de los miembros del jurado. El sistema que queremos realizar es el siguiente. Hay dos tribunales A y B. El tribunal A tiene cuatro miembros (a,b,c,d) y el tribunal B tres (e, f, g). El veredicto deber ser: El del tribunal A en caso de que en ste no se produzca empate. y Si se produce empate el en tribunal A, el veredicto ser el del tribunal B. Se recomienda disear el circuito segn el diagrama de bloques de la figura. y 17. Una mquina expendedora de tabaco proporciona diversas marcas con precios de 10, 20, 30 y 50 soles. Slo admite una moneda de 10, 20 50 para adquirir el paquete, y slo devuelve cambio de 1 moneda, en caso de que lo hubiera. Habr casos en los que, al no poder proporcionar el cambio correcto reintegrar la moneda introducida, sin proporcionar tabaco. disear el circuito lgico digital que realiza esta funcin y su diagrama circuital. 18. El esquema de la figura representa el sistema de llenado de dos depsitos de combustible. Para el control de este sistema se dispone de una electrovlvula de cierre y otra de seleccin de depsito gobernadas por las seales digitales X e Y respectivamente. Cuando la seal X est a 0 la electrovlvula de entrada se abre y cuando est a 1 se cierra. La electrovlvula de seleccin de depsito dirige todo el caudal de entrada al depsito 1 cuando la seal Y est a 0 y al depsito 2 en caso contrario. Para el control del nivel de los depsitos se han dispuesto cuatro detectores de nivel a, b, c y d. Estos detectores proporcionan una seal digital que toma valor 1 cuando el nivel de combustible sube por encima de la posicin del sensor y permanece a 0 en otro caso. Los detectores a y c indican el nivel mnimo de los depsitos y b y d el nivel mximo. El comportamiento deseado para el sistema de control debe cumplir las siguientes reglas: y Si ambos depsitos estn por debajo del mnimo el caudal de entrada debe dirigirse al depsito 1. y Si ambos depsitos estn a medias (por encima del mnimo y por debajo del mximo) el caudal de entrada debe dirigirse tambin al depsito 1. y Si se alcanza el nivel mximo en los dos depsitos se debe cerrar laelectrovlvula de entrada. y En caso de que el nivel detectado en un depsito sea superior al del otro el caudal de entrada se dirigir al depsito ms vaco. y En caso de deteccin anmala de nivel (nivel por encima del mximo y por debajo del mnimo simultneamente en alguno de los depsitos) se cerrar la electrovlvula de entrada por seguridad. y Cuando la electrovlvula de entrada est cerrada el valor de la seal de seleccin de depsito es irrelevante. Determinar la tabla de verdad del circuito necesario para el gobierno de las seales X e Y a partir de los niveles de a, b, c y d. Realizar el circuito de control empleando para ello multiplexores del menor nmero posible de lneas de seleccin (y puertas NOT si fuera necesario).

19. Para la realizacin de un sistema de votacin rpida en una cmara con un presidente y tres vocales se desea instalar un sistema de cuenta electrnica de los votos. Todos los miembros de la cmara disponen de dos pulsadores: uno para votar a favor y otro en contra. El esquema de la figura muestra los bloques que componen el sistema de votacin. Disear el bloque de control del nmero de votos de forma que cumpla las siguientes especificaciones: y y y y En caso de que la mayora de votos sean a favor la seal resultado deber ponerse a 1. En caso de que la mayora de votos sean en contra la seal resultado deber ponerse a 0. En caso de empate la salida empate se pondr a 1 y la seal resultado tomar el valor que indique el voto del presidente. En caso de que no exista empate la salida empate permanecer a valor 0

Realizar el diseo del empleando el menor nmero posible de puertas NAND de dos entradas.

20. Se desea controlar dos bombas B1 y B2 de acuerdo con el nivel de lquido existente en undepsito. Su funcionamiento ha de ser tal como se indica a continuacin. Cuando el nivel delquido se encuentra comprendido entre los dos sensores c y d, debe funcionar la bomba B1( o B2 si la temperatura de su motor alcanza un cierto lmite prefijado), y se para cuando seactiva el sensor d. Si el nivel de lquido se encuentra por debajo de c se deben de activarambas bombas. En caso de funcionamiento anormal de los sensores del depsito (se active d cuando no loest c), ambas bombas se pararn.Adems, ambas bombas cuentan con sendos detectores de temperatura a y b para B1 y B2respectivamente, de forma que si la

temperatura de su motor supera un cierto lmite, el detectorse activar y la correspondiente bomba se debe parar de forma automtica. Se pide disear el circuito de control segn el orden siguiente: 1. Obtener la tabla de verdad. 2. Expresar las funciones en forma de minterms y simplificarlas por Karnaugh. 3. Implementar el circuito de control de la seal B1con puertas NAND. 4. Implementar el circuito de control de la seal B2 con puertas NOR.

Vous aimerez peut-être aussi